Can You Put Lemon Juice on Watermelon?

Published in Fruit Combinations 2 mins read

Yes, you can put lemon juice on watermelon.

Enhancing Watermelon Flavor with Lemon Juice

While watermelon is naturally sweet and refreshing, its flavor can sometimes be a bit one-dimensional. The addition of lemon juice can provide a delightful depth of flavor, appealing to those seeking a more complex taste profile.

Why Add Lemon Juice to Watermelon?

  • Adds Acidity: Lemon juice introduces acidity, which can cut through the sweetness of the watermelon, creating a more balanced flavor.
  • Increases Complexity: The tartness of lemon juice complements the sweetness of the watermelon, adding layers of flavor that prevent the taste from being too simple.
  • Enhances Freshness: The citrus notes of lemon juice can enhance the refreshing qualities of watermelon, making it an even more enjoyable treat, especially on a hot day.
  • Flavor Depth: For individuals who prefer a more nuanced taste, lemon juice provides an extra dimension to the overall flavor experience of watermelon. As per the reference, the addition of lemon juice is perfect for people who want a little more depth of flavor.

How to Use Lemon Juice on Watermelon

  1. Freshly Squeezed: Use freshly squeezed lemon juice for the best flavor. Bottled lemon juice can sometimes have a less vibrant taste.
  2. Sprinkling: Lightly sprinkle lemon juice over slices or chunks of watermelon.
  3. Experiment: Start with a small amount and add more to taste. The goal is to enhance the flavor, not to overpower it.
  4. Other Additions: Consider adding a pinch of salt, which can further enhance both the sweetness and tartness of the combination. Mint leaves can add freshness.

When to Add Lemon Juice

  • Before Serving: Add lemon juice just before serving to prevent the watermelon from becoming too soggy.
  • In Salads: Lemon juice can be a great addition to watermelon salads, complementing other ingredients like feta cheese or mint.

By incorporating lemon juice, you can elevate the taste of watermelon, providing a refreshing and complex flavor profile.
